Amrit Bharat Station Scheme: Old buildings of Sultanpur Railway Station to be demolished next month

The redevelopment of Sultanpur Railway Station under the Amrit Bharat Station Scheme is gaining speed. Railway authorities have decided to demolish old station buildings by the first week of July to make way for modern infrastructure. This move will clear space for a new station layout and improve overall passenger movement.

Which buildings will be demolished and why?

The demolition will cover buildings within an 80-meter radius in the first phase. This includes the running room, signal section, parcel building, CMI office, and the Station Superintendent’s office. Gorja Construction Company from Haryana, which holds the tender for Sultanpur and Lambhua stations, will oversee the work. Removing these structures, including the Union and Northern Railway Mess buildings, is necessary to build the new station house.

What new facilities will passengers get?

The upgraded station will focus on modern amenities and better traffic management to end the frequent jams outside the station. The project includes several high-tech upgrades:

Feature Details
Building Structure Portico with first and second floors
Connectivity 12-meter wide Foot Over Bridge (FOB)
Accessibility Lifts and escalators from Platform 1 to 4
Technology Wi-Fi facilities and modern lighting
Special Needs Dedicated provisions for Divyang passengers
Sanitation Modernized toilet blocks

When will the project be completed?

Railway officials stated that the full range of facilities will be available for passengers by December 2026. The redevelopment is part of a larger initiative started by Prime Minister Narendra Modi in September 2023 to upgrade 508 stations across India. For the Sultanpur and Lambhua redevelopment, a total budget of 36.85 crore rupees has been approved, with over 19 crore rupees being invested specifically in Sultanpur.
